관련 글들을 블럭으로 출력하고 싶은 경우 : Similar Entries 모듈

제목 : 관련 글들을 블럭으로 출력하고 싶은 경우 : Similar Entries 모듈.

본 사이트의 각 게시글들의 하단(2008년 2월 기준)에 보면,
"이 글과 관련이 있나요?" 라는 관련글 블럭이 보인다.

이 기능은 현재의 게시글들에 있는 문자열들을 분석해서 가장 비슷하거나 관련있는 다른 게시글들을 리스트로 출력해 주는 것이다.

이와 비슷한 기능을 하는 모듈이 몇몇 있는 것 같은데,
이 중에 본 사이트는 Similar Entries 모듈을 채택하고 있다. 이유는... "적용이 간단해서"이다.


similar 모듈의 설정화면: 일본어판 드루팔에서 캡쳐했습니다. 관리자 권한으로 http://드루팔주소/admin/settings/similar 에 가 보면 본 이미지와 같은 화면이 나옵니다. 캐쉬를 쓰게 되면(유효), 아무래도 similar 블럭의 출력까지의 시간이 조금은 절약될 겁니다.

Similar Entries 모듈을 적용하는 순서에 대해 알아보자.

1. 아래의 웹주소에서 모듈 최신판을 구하자.
   http://drupal.org/project/similar  (최신판으로 다운로드하는 것을 추천)
2. 압축을 해제해서 모듈을 드루팔의 모듈폴더에 넣고,
   관리 > 사이트 구성 > 모듈에 가서,
   Similar Entries 모듈을 활성화하자.
3. 관리 > 사이트 구성 > 블럭에 가 보면,
   Similar Entries 항목이 있다.
   이를 원하는 블럭 영역으로 공개 설정하자.
4. 블럭을 설정한 후에는, Similar Entries 항목의
   편집을 눌러서 블럭의 제목이나 캐쉬 여부를 설정하자.
5. 아무 게시글이나 열람해서 해당 블럭에 관련글들이
   나타나는지 확인한다.

 
주의) 5번의 확인은, 관리 화면이나 Top 화면에서는
보이지 않을 수도 있다. 관련글을 출력하는 것이니까...

Your rating: None 평균 : 4.4 (5 votes)

댓글

관련글 출력하는

관련글 출력하는 것으로, 아래의 모듈들도 있다.
http://drupal.org/project/relatedcontent
http://drupal.org/project/related_nodes

다음에 이 모듈들도 시험해 보도록 하겠다.

중요해서 다시 강조!

중요해서 다시 강조! 각 컨텐츠 타입별로 이 관련글(similar, 닮은) 블럭을 보여줄지 말지 여부를 결정하는 인터페이스는,
관리 > 사이트 구성 > *** 블럭 ***에 있는 Similar entries 의 편집을 눌러 보면 체크 박스 형태로 선택할 수 있습니다.

드루팔의 마이너

드루팔의 마이너 업그레이드 후 관리 화면에서 Similar entries 메뉴가 보이지 않는 경우가 있다.
이러한 때에는 모듈에서 Similar entries 를 일단 Off 설정한 후, 모듈의 재설치를 시도해 보면 잘 나타난다.
특히 설치할 때의 폴더를 modules 가 아닌 sites/default/modules 로 바꾸어서 해 보라. 혹은 그 반대로.

* 관련글 모듈에

* 관련글 모듈에 관한, 다음의 비교 기사도 참고해 볼 필요가 있다.
Comparison of Similiar / Relevant by term block modules.
http://drupal.org/node/323329

비슷한 모듈 추가)

* Similar By Terms 모듈 - http://drupal.org/project/similarterms
Taxonomy를 기준으로 유사한 컨텐츠를 연결, 블럭 또는 각종 키워드 형태로 제공한다.

* Relevant Content 모듈 : http://drupal.org/project/relevant_content
연관성 있는 컨텐츠를 참고할 수 있도록 한다?! Similar 모듈과 비슷한 역할인가?
현재 컨텐츠의 카테고리 베이스에서 가장 연관성이 높은 컨텐츠를 알려준다?! (조사 중)